In August and early September, LiverWELL Health Promotion Officers Alain and Maddie delivered 12 hepatitis B workshops at Box Hill Institute’s Elgar Campus for students in the Adult Migrant English Program (AMEP). More than 265 students participated in sessions that combined health education with language support, creating a safe and inclusive environment where participants could learn, ask questions, and build confidence in navigating the healthcare system.
The workshops broke down barriers to health literacy through storytelling and interactive activities. Topics included hepatitis B transmission, testing, vaccination, care and management, and how to talk with a doctor about your liver health. These sessions not only increased awareness but also addressed stigma and helped build trust in Australia’s healthcare system. Designed to align with the AMEP language curriculum, the sessions integrated relevant vocabulary, listening and speaking activities, and medical terminology, which are essential skills for effective for real-life medical appointments.

In 2025, LiverWELL reached over 1,000 AMEP students, with 90% reporting increased knowledge and 91% noting positive changes in attitude or behaviour related to their health.
